I love my LC-1. I have 2, one I run with an XD-16 and the other I run with just a basic guage. To be honest, when I am tuning I never look at the guage and just let hptuners do the work. In hind sight, I think I probably would just say forget the guages all together (or maybe just use the basic guage and not the xd-16) and just let the laptop do the work. Once you are tuned and everything is working great, you won't even need to look at the guage anyway.

Innovate. I love my LC-1 with XD-1 gauge. I have installed several wideband's, including the AEM. Installation was pretty much the same for both. The gauge is awesome also. Very thin so you can mount it anywhere and visible in the daytime. It also reads a wider range too.

LC1 - I've been using mine for a couple years now with no issues. Install is not hard unless you completely dork up the wiring, and replacement sensors are easy to source and not expensive if you know where to look. I also use the XD-16 gauge, and wouldn't use any other.

I went with the WBC because I wanted more features from the unit than the guage. The big cost with the lc1 and xd16 is the guage. This unit is compact and fully configurable with an output circuit controlled by parameters you set for say a nitrous system or boost. It's a sweet unit and comes with an autometer guage an you know how they are. Send it to them and they'll put any face you want on it.
